Zubin Mehta

Zubin Mehta

Zubin Mehta, born April 29, 1936 in Mumbai, India, is one of the world's most celebrated conductors. He has served as Music Director of the New York Philharmonic, Los Angeles Philharmonic, Montreal Symphony Orchestra, and Munich Philharmonic. Known for his passionate and dynamic conducting style, Mehta has worked with virtually every major orchestra and opera house globally, including the Metropolitan Opera and La Scala. He is widely regarded as one of the greatest conductors of our time.

Esa-Pekka Salonen

Esa-Pekka Salonen

Esa-Pekka Salonen is a prominent Finnish conductor recognized for his international contributions to classical music. Born on June 30, 1958, he has been a leading figure in orchestral conducting, serving as principal conductor of the Los Angeles Philharmonic and the London Symphony Orchestra, among others. Salonen's innovative approach to music has earned him numerous accolades, including the Polar Music Prize and the Praemium Imperiale.

Nobuo Uematsu

Nobuo Uematsu

Nobuo Uematsu is a highly respected composer in the video game industry, known for his work on the soundtracks of numerous iconic video games, particularly the Final Fantasy series. Born on March 21, 1959, Uematsu's compositions are celebrated for their melodic richness and thematic depth, solidifying his status as one of the most influential composers in the industry.
